DLNA IPTV xupnpd

9 декабря 2013
Рубрика: Linux, Ubuntu, vanoc.ru
Теги: , ,

vanoc

Купили брату телевизор Sony Bravia. Выбирал специально, чтоб ТВ умел проигрывать много форматов видео и знал что такое DLNA. Однако упустил IPTV. Странно, но ТВ его совсем не умеет проигрывать. Удивительно, что Sony не позаботились об этом. В итоге IPTV таки удалось получить, пусть и через DLNA.

Настраивается установкой xupnpd. Можно поставить программу на роутер. В интернете есть мануалы по ентой установке. У меня же стояла задача более простая. Заставить ТВ показывать iptv не важно откуда. В итоге поставил xupnpd на ноут с ubuntu, благо на оффсайте есть уже собранный пакет для нее.

Правим конфиг файл /etc/xupnpd.lua
Заменяем интерфейс на свой, через который выходим в интернет.

Запускать следует через sudo.
sudo xupnpd

Либо можно утянуть последнюю версию с svn

sudo apt-get install subversion
svn co http://tsdemuxer.googlecode.com/svn/trunk/xupnpd
cd xupnpd/src/
make

Не забываем поправить конфиг файл xupnpd.lua
Следует заменить интерфейс на свой, через который выходим в интернет.

Запускаем программу
chmod +x xupnpd
./xupnpd

Дальше настройки можно править через веб-интерфейс 192.168.X.X:4044, где 192.168.X.X ваш ip.
Там же можно загрузить свой плейлист.m3u

Ввиду того, что я смотрю iptv от тетушки Шуры и потоки там все http-шные, мне не пришлось ставить udpxy. Единственный нюанс, который заставил меня поломать голову, из-за того, что при выборе канала трансляция запускалась, но картинки не было, заключается в том, что в настройках Default mime type следует указать mpeg_ts (cfg.default_mime_type=’mpeg_ts’).

8 комментариев для “DLNA IPTV xupnpd”

  1. zahareeivici26 января 2014 ~ 15:14

    vreode vse ustanavil kogda hochu zagruzit svoi playlist pishet fail shto mne delati?

  2. vanoc27 января 2014 ~ 00:39

    zahareeivici, как устанавливали? Возможно у вас не хватает прав на запись. Плейлисты находятся в директории xupnpd/src/playlists/ Как вариант можно скопировать туда плейлист, он должен отобразиться в списке.

  3. vlad51424 августа 2014 ~ 08:34

    Здравствуйте. Извините, если немного не в тему. Xupnpd пользуюсь уже довольно давно, работает нормально, но есть один вопрос. Можно ли плейлисты разложить по каталогам, чтобы удобнее было в них ориентироватся. Создание папок в \disk_a1\system\usr\share\xupnpd\playlists ничего не дает (не видит).

  4. vanoc24 августа 2014 ~ 10:32

    vlad514, не знаю может ли это делать Xupnpd, у меня не так много плейлистов. Однако на этот вопрос смогут ответить авторы проекта http://xupnpd.org/t/index_ru.html#Feedback

  5. Alex18 октября 2014 ~ 16:28

    добрый…
    подскажите плиз как смотреть iptv
    на Sony модель KDL-42W817B, роутер Asus RT-N12VP
    с поддержкой IPTV
    Не судите строго, я новичок, буду благодарен за пошаговый алгоритм.

  6. vanoc20 октября 2014 ~ 11:27

    Alex, привет. Пошагового алгоритма не дам, т.к. на роутер xupnpd я не ставил. Устанавливал на компьютер с ubuntu linux. Если у тебя такой в наличии имеется (в принципе достаточно виртуалки с линуксом), то ман выше.

  7. mx-lin19 августа 2015 ~ 19:53

    Скачал (rev.405), пытаюсь установить на Ubuntu 14.04.3, в результате make получаю:
    mcast.cpp:15:23: fatal error: uuid/uuid.h: No such file or directory
    #include
    ^
    compilation terminated.
    make: *** [x86] Error 1

    что бы это могло быть?

  8. mx-lin19 августа 2015 ~ 20:54

    извини, поторопился, она же говорит uuid, вот и надо было доустановить uuid-dev.

Ваш комментарий

*